Naoya Inoue and Junto Nakatani will headline one of the biggest boxing fights on the 2026 calendar. Both fighters will face off at Tokyo Dome Arena in Tokyo, Japan, this Saturday, May 2 (6 a.m. ET / 3 a.m. PT), for the undisputed super bantamweight championship, where “The Monster” will defend his WBC, WBO, IBF, and WBA titles. Do you want to watch the fight on your Smart TV, tablet, mobile phone, or PC? Here we tell you which TV channel and streaming service hold the exclusive rights to this boxing event.

In the United States, the fight between Naoya Inoue and Junto Nakatani will be streamed via Amazon DAZN Boxing PPV ($79.99). In Mexico, meanwhile, it will be available live online on ESPN KnockOut and through the Disney Plus Premium app.

In the rest of Latin America, including countries such as Argentina, Colombia, Peru, and Chile, the live broadcast of the Naoya Inoue vs. Junto Nakatani showdown will be carried by ESPN and the Disney+ Premium platform, in addition to being available globally through DAZN.

If you are in Spain and want to enjoy the Naoya Inoue vs. Junto Nakatani fight, you will need to subscribe to the DAZN streaming service to watch it.
